Ukraine has moved a step closer to producing SCALP cruise missiles at home after Britain agreed to provide information on UK-made components of the Franco-British weapon.
The decision clears the way for the missiles to be assembled in Ukraine following months of negotiations between Kyiv and Paris over licensing and local production.
Luke Pollard, the UK's Minister for Defence Readiness and Industry, said the move should strengthen Ukraine’s defensive capabilities.
